The computer operators should have access to both program documentation and operations manuals. This is because they need to understand not only how the systems operate, but also how to use the programs that run on those systems.
Program documentation provides information on the specific programs and how they work. It includes details on the various features, functions, and commands of the programs.
On the other hand, operations manuals provide instructions on how to operate the systems themselves. They typically cover information such as system startup, shutdown, backup procedures, and troubleshooting steps.
